Sixteen people died in a fire that broke out on Friday night at a nursing home in Comuy, located in the Pitrufquén commune of Chile's La Araucanía region. The facility was operating without the necessary legal authorizations required for such establishments.
Authorities are currently investigating the incident following the loss of life in the southern Chilean facility. The lack of regulatory compliance at the residence has been identified as a central factor in the reporting of the tragedy.
